    Yeah, mostly we have the Ford Crown Vics; they're pretty much the only vehicles that are being fleet equipped for cops aside from the Impys which make pretty lousy cop cars, IMHO. But the California Highway Patrol does have some Camaro Z/28's that they bust out for the high speed pursuits.

    People rarely get a way from the police. The reason you don't see them really end a chase is because pretty much every police jurisdiction has instructions not to do it that way. So, you usually see them bust out the spike strips or hope the bad guy does something stupid instead. But with helicopters in pursuit, it would be pretty hard to really actually get away.
